No dangers from Listeria bacteria - Dr. Ginige

Dr. Samitha Ginige, head of the Epidemiology Unit of the Health Ministry, told Daily News yesterday (20) that the Listeria bacteria reported from Sripada will not develop into an epidemic situation.

Dr. Samitha Ginige said that the people should not have any fear in this regard. He pointed out that the information published on social media about this bacterium is not true. However, if this bacterium enters the body of people with chronic diseases, various complications might occur, he said.

He said that this bacteria spreads through food and water and only one death of a person infected with the Listeria bacteria has been reported so far. “The people participating in the Siripada pilgrimage should not have undue fear of this bacteria and they should take steps to obtain food and water safely,” he pointed out.

Dr. Samitha Ginige said that the food and water samples taken from the shops and hotels located in the Sripada area are regularly tested and none of the tested samples has contained Listeria bacteria so far.
